Resident Engagement Supervisor

The Mather (Tysons, VA)

We are seeking a Resident Engagement Supervisor to contribute to a team of wellness and engagement professionals who facilitate a variety of programs, events, partnerships and more that support Ways to Age Well for residents across the continuum. The Engagement Supervisor implements a robust calendar of group and individual programs that support high levels of resident engagement in Assisted Living, Memory Support, and Skilled Nursing. 

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

  • Delivers programs for Life Center residents following Culture of Creativity model: including best practices for group and 1:1 engagement with music, movement, storytelling/legacy, nature immersion, culinary arts, sensory experience, inquiry-based learning, and meaningful celebrations of holidays & rituals within daily routine. Implements best practices for engaging residents with diverse physical, cognitive and emotional needs.
  • Develops Life Center programs calendars meeting Mather standards for engagement and wellness: and ensures that programs occur as scheduled via personally facilitating programs & supporting programs led by colleagues, independent contractors and volunteers. Contributes ideas to support program development across the continuum. Facilitates outings/events and participation of Life Center residents in broader community events, and amenities.
  • Completes required assessment processes for regulatory compliance including care plan notes and documentation within the EMR system. Supports MDS process as required. Translates residents’ personal interests and needs developed within assessment and care plan procedures into unique individual and group engagement opportunities and programs within the Life Center calendar. ‘Attends care plan meetings as directed.
  • Provides daily supervision of engagement coordinators including day-to-day coaching in program delivery, resident engagement, and assessment/documentation completion.

About The Mather:

The Mather is a Life Plan Community in Tysons, Virginia, for those 62 and better that defies expectations of what senior living is supposed to be. More than a luxury residence, The Mather is in an enviable walkable, urban neighborhood, close to the Metro and all the DC area has to offer. Opened in March 2024, The Mather includes 293 independent living apartment homes, as well as assisted living, memory support, and skilled nursing, along with multiple restaurants, a fitness center, art studio, gardens and more.
